Kalandri

Kalandri is a city in sirohi district in Rajasthan state in India. It is located about 15 km west of Sirohi. Kalandari is the headquarters of a sub tehsil of the district. The Jawahar Navodaya Vidyalaya of Sirohi district is based here.[1] 90% population depends on agriculture. The main temple of the city is Shri Kalinga ji whose temple is on a small hill in the middle of the city. Government senior secondary school in Kalandri city is one of the oldest school in the region which was built pre-independence in 1946. Brahma ji Mandir is a temple often visited by thousands of people for spiritual activities and faith.
